How to make a hidden pocket pouch Step 1. Cut out the fabric piece for the secret pouch pocket I am assuming that you will have your passport credit cards and maybe some money to keep in this pocket - for this, you need a pocket of the following dimensions Width - 5.5″ ; Length - 7.5″ Cut out a cloth that is 17″ long and 6.5″ wide.

Step 1. Ashley Poskin. To draft a pattern for your pocket, place your hand diagonally on a sheet of paper. Starting at the bottom corner, generously trace around your hand, creating a half-heart shape. Trace at least 2 inches from the tips of your fingers to the pattern's edge. 04 of 12.

Cut two pocket pieces from the scrap knit fabric 6 inches wide and 10 inches tall. Place the pocket lining pieces with the right side of the lining to the wrong side of the zipper and pin in place. Sew the pocket linings in place with a zipper foot. Backstitch when you start and when you stop.

Step 1 First cut out four pocket shapes big enough to fit the size of your hand. The shape is kind of like a kidney bean only with a straight side on one of the sides. Step 2 Measure the length for where you want your pockets to start. Normally for me it's only a few inches down from the waist depending on where the waistline starts on the skirt.

Steps 1-6. Line up one of the pocket pieces right side together with the front of the dress. Sew down the side (5/8″ seam allowance). Fold the pocket piece away from the garment and press along the seam. With the pocket piece still facing away from the garment, top stitch just a few millimetres next to that first stitch.
